How much do oracle data analyst j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for oracle data analyst in Wisconsin is $83,413.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$63,100.00 and $97,900.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an Oracle Data Analyst job?

An Oracle Data Analyst is responsible for analyzing, managing, and interpreting data within Oracle databases to support business decision-making. They use SQL, data visualization tools, and analytical techniques to extract insights, generate reports, and optimize database performance. Their role often involves ensuring data integrity, developing dashboards, and collaborating with teams to improve data-driven strategies. Strong knowledge of Oracle database systems, PL/SQL, and data modeling is essential for success in this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Oracle Data Analyst position,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Oracle Data Analyst, you need strong analytical skills, experience with Oracle databases, SQL proficiency, and typically a degree in computer science, information systems, or a related field. Familiarity with Oracle Business Intelligence (OBIEE), data visualization tools, and Oracle certification (such as Oracle Database SQL Certified Associate) are highly valued. Att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ication skills help distinguish top candidates in this role. These competencies are crucial for accurately interpreting data, providing actionable insights, and effectively collaborating with technical and business stakeholders.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of an Oracle Data Analyst?

An Oracle Data Analyst typically spends their day extracting, cleaning, and analyzing data from various Oracle databases to support business decision-making. They work closely with business teams to understand requirements, design queries and reports, and ensure data accuracy and integrity. Regular responsibilities may also include troubleshooting data discrepancies, optimizing data queries for efficiency, and preparing dashboards or visualizations using business intelligence tools. Collaboration with database administrators, developers, and end-users is common to ensure that data solutions align with company goals and technical standards.
